Function that converts absorbance (a.u.) into transmittance (fraction).
Usage
A2T(x, action, byref, ...)
# Default S3 method
A2T(x, action = NULL, byref = FALSE, ...)
# S3 method for class 'numeric'
A2T(x, action = NULL, byref = FALSE, ...)
# S3 method for class 'filter_spct'
A2T(x, action = "add", byref = FALSE, ...)
# S3 method for class 'filter_mspct'
A2T(x, action = "add", byref = FALSE, ..., .parallel = FALSE, .paropts = NULL)Arguments
- x
an R object.
- action
a character string "add" or "replace".
- byref
logical indicating if new object will be created by reference or by copy of
x.- ...
not used in current version.
- .parallel
if TRUE, apply function in parallel, using parallel backend provided by foreach
- .paropts
a list of additional options passed into the foreach function when parallel computation is enabled. This is important if (for example) your code relies on external data or packages: use the .export and .packages arguments to supply them so that all cluster nodes have the correct environment set up for computing.
Value
A copy of x with a column Tfr added and A and
Afr possibly deleted except for w.length. If action =
"replace", in all cases, the additional columns are removed, even if no
column needs to be added.
Methods (by class)
A2T(default): Default method for generic functionA2T(numeric): method for numeric vectorsA2T(filter_spct): Method for filter spectraA2T(filter_mspct): Method for collections of filter spectra
See also
Other quantity conversion functions:
Afr2T(),
T2A(),
T2Afr(),
any2T(),
as_quantum(),
e2q(),
e2qmol_multipliers(),
e2quantum_multipliers(),
q2e()
